# Holiday Opening Hours — Marlowe House

Heads up, facilities folks: over the winter shutdown (24 Dec–2 Jan), Marlowe House runs on skeleton hours. Main doors open 08:00–14:00 only, and the east atrium stays locked the whole period. Kestrel Catering won't be on site, so the kitchenette fridges get emptied on the 23rd — label anything you want kept.

The side entrance on Fenwick Lane remains badge-only. If the reader is sluggish (it gets cranky in the cold), fall back to the keypad using the holiday access code below.

door code, yagap-bahof: bdg-O-05

## Support

The Fernwick CSV Import Wizard parses untrusted user uploads, so we treat all parser bugs as potential security issues. Findings should be reported privately rather than in the public tracker. Include a minimal reproducing file and the wizard version. For disclosure questions or to report a vulnerability, contact the Fernwick security desk.

escalation mailbox, fajef-fawig: ulair_briius_drueth@paliqcorp.example

## Changed defaults

Heads up, plugin folks: Gustfront's alert fan-out no longer broadcasts to every subscriber on a severity bump. As of 4.2 we only re-notify channels that opted into escalations, which cuts duplicate pings way down. If your plugin relied on the old firehose behaviour, you'll want to set the opt-in flag explicitly. The new defaults shipped with the service are shown below.

deployment values, faduf-tawep:
SORDOR_LOG_LEVEL=error
SORDOR_METRICS_HOST=metrics.sordor.nelvrolabs.internal
SORDOR_POOL_SIZE=4

## Env vars: DB pooling

Quick note for reviewers of the Burrowbase pool changes: `POOL_MIN` and `POOL_MAX` now default to 4/32, and idle timeout moved to `POOL_IDLE_MS`. Don't approve PRs that hardcode pool sizes in code. The pooler also needs the database credential set in the env file, on the line right after `POOL_MAX`:

sealed setting: VAULT_KEY20=c8ea1e419912889df6b4

Handover note — bulk edits in the Ledgerbird admin table. Please read carefully before touching anything. Bulk edits bypass the per-row validation hooks, so a bad filter can overwrite hundreds of records with no undo. Always run the dry-run mode first and export a snapshot before committing. I've documented the known edge cases in the shared runbook. If anything looks off, stop and escalate. The engineer now responsible for this area is named below.

approver of hahig-kahap = Fraeth Nordor Normir